2018-01-09 18:25:38 -08:00
|
|
|
import React from 'react';
|
2018-01-12 15:02:42 -08:00
|
|
|
import PropTypes from 'prop-types';
|
2018-01-09 18:25:38 -08:00
|
|
|
|
2018-01-24 12:02:40 -08:00
|
|
|
function UrlMiddle ({publishInChannel, selectedChannel, loggedInChannelName, loggedInChannelShortId}) {
|
2018-01-09 18:49:26 -08:00
|
|
|
if (publishInChannel) {
|
2018-01-24 12:02:40 -08:00
|
|
|
if (selectedChannel === loggedInChannelName) {
|
2018-03-07 20:18:17 -08:00
|
|
|
return <span id='url-channel' className='url-text--secondary'>{loggedInChannelName}:{loggedInChannelShortId} /</span>;
|
2018-01-09 18:25:38 -08:00
|
|
|
}
|
2018-03-07 20:18:17 -08:00
|
|
|
return <span id='url-channel-placeholder' className='url-text--secondary tooltip'>@channel<span
|
|
|
|
className='tooltip-text'>Select a channel below</span> /</span>;
|
2018-01-09 18:25:38 -08:00
|
|
|
}
|
|
|
|
return (
|
2018-03-07 20:18:17 -08:00
|
|
|
<span id='url-no-channel-placeholder' className='url-text--secondary tooltip'>xyz<span className='tooltip-text'>This will be a random id</span> /</span>
|
2018-01-09 18:25:38 -08:00
|
|
|
);
|
|
|
|
}
|
|
|
|
|
2018-01-12 15:02:42 -08:00
|
|
|
UrlMiddle.propTypes = {
|
|
|
|
publishInChannel : PropTypes.bool.isRequired,
|
2018-01-18 10:13:51 -08:00
|
|
|
loggedInChannelName : PropTypes.string,
|
|
|
|
loggedInChannelShortId: PropTypes.string,
|
2018-01-12 15:02:42 -08:00
|
|
|
};
|
|
|
|
|
2018-01-09 18:25:38 -08:00
|
|
|
export default UrlMiddle;
|